Role Summary
Design and implement high-performance physical-layer ASIC blocks for wired data communications in the Connectivity Group. Work on RTL architecture, micro-architecture, verification and ASIC implementation across global teams.
Experience Level
Entry-level (1–3 years of relevant ASIC, DSP or RTL experience).
Responsibilities
Key responsibilities include:
- Develop ASIC specifications, architecture and micro-architecture for major functional blocks in complex SoC solutions.
- Implement and simulate RTL using Verilog/SystemVerilog; participate in synthesis and implementation for ASIC flow.
- Create and execute verification plans; perform lint, CDC and power analysis and act on findings.
- Analyze and optimize datapath and DSP circuit designs for high-performance and high-volume manufacture.
- Participate in design and verification reviews and collaborate with cross-functional and global teams.
